Notre Dame Still Unbeaten in Big East

Associated Press

Kelley Siemon scored a career-high 23 points Tuesday night as fifth-ranked Notre Dame, 18-2 overall and 9-0 in the Big East, rolled to a 90-60 victory over Providence (9-10, 4-5) at Providence, R.I.

In other games involving top 25 teams: Marie Ferdinand scored 19 points to lead No. 7 Louisiana State (17-3) to a 67-30 rout of Centenary (0-20) at Baton Rouge, La. . . . Tammy Sutton-Brown and Shawnetta Stewart each scored 15 points as No. 10 Rutgers (14-4) hung on for a 58-50 victory over No. 16 Old Dominion (14-4) at Piscataway, N.J. . . . Lynn Pride had 21 points and grabbed 13 rebounds for No. 25 Kansas (15-5, 6-2) in a 74-66 Big 12 victory over Colorado (6-13, 1-7) at Boulder, Colo.
